Philosophical & Societal Implications:
- What are the ethical implications of the measure? Who should have access to this information?
- How do you think society would react if the measure existed in real life?
- What does the novel say about the human experience of grief and death?
- Do you think the measure could be used for good? Could it lead to a more fulfilling or meaningful life?
